Exploring Advanced Polymer Machining Techniques And Technologies

Polymer machining is a complex process that requires advanced technologies and techniques for precision cutting and shaping of polymer components. This process is used in a wide range of industries, from medical device manufacturing to consumer electronics. In order to produce high-quality components, advanced machining techniques must be employed. These include laser cutting, waterjet cutting, and CNC machining. Laser cutting is a highly precise process that uses a laser beam to cut through polymer components with a high degree of accuracy.

Advanced machining techniques also involve the use of specialized tools and materials. These include special cutting tools, abrasives, and coatings. Cutting tools are used to create precise shapes and sizes for components. Abrasives are used to achieve a smooth finish and to reduce friction during the machining process. 

Finally, advanced polymer machining technologies involve the use of advanced software technologies. CAD/CAM software is used to create 3D models of components and to generate precise instructions for CNC machining.
